This was the first and only round of interviews. It was a panel interview with 6 other people. They started with behavioral questions, then moved to technical questions related to my resume. The cyber risk questions were straightforward and manageable, as expected. The atmosphere was very relaxed, and the interviewers were welcoming and created a positive environment. It was enjoyable to connect with the team and learn more about each other. I was quite happy with the experience!

Confirmed questions2 questions
  • Could you tell me about a challenging situation you encountered and how you handled it?
  • Tell me about your experience with cyber risk.

First, I toured the office. Then, I sat down with three employees. They were dressed very casually, like in jeans and t-shirts, and some hadn't shaved. I was asked some easy questions about myself and my goals. I had to write code for a method while they watched. One interviewer was pretty tough on me while I was coding. I heard from friends that this is normal, with one interviewer usually being difficult. I didn't love the people, but the office was cool.

Confirmed questions1 question
  • Could you write a recursive method to achieve this task...
